Stimulant drugs

Stimulant drugs enhance attention and concentration in 70 to 80% of adults and children who take them. They affect the neurotransmitters involved in the brain, like dopamine and norepinephrine. They typically cause an initial increase in blood pressure and heart rate that lasts for several hours. Due to this, experts recommend that patients start low and build up to the recommended dosage over a period of weeks.

Stimant medication is taken by mouth, typically every day, either once or twice. The majority are available in long- and short-acting formulas. Short-acting stimulants begin to show their effects after a short time and should be taken 3 times a day; long-acting stimulants last for 8-12 hours and are taken twice a day.

These medications can cause undesirable side effects, including nausea, insomnia and loss of appetite. Some people might become irritable or moody. However the effects typically diminish over time and can be controlled by changing the dosage. In certain instances, stimulants can cause changes in personality, for example becoming more withdrawn, irritable or becoming more rigid and obsessive. They can also increase the risk of other mental disorders, such as mania and depression.

The majority of stimulants are controlled substances, and require a prescription to be obtained. They are frequently misused by adults and teens to achieve performance enhancement, and they can lead to addiction if used in a way that is not prescribed. Because of these risks, doctors carefully consider the need for stimulant medications and keep track of the dosage and adverse effects.
